From e8366d4a60a102daa672a95e3e780d65349e485a Mon Sep 17 00:00:00 2001 From: ogzhanolguncu Date: Wed, 28 May 2025 14:10:04 +0300 Subject: [PATCH 1/4] chore: linter date time fixes --- .../components/expiration-setup.tsx | 3 +-- .../create-key/create-key.schema.ts | 2 +- apps/dashboard/components/ui/chart.tsx | 1 + apps/dashboard/lib/zod-helper.ts | 2 +- biome.json | 19 +++++++++++++++---- 5 files changed, 19 insertions(+), 8 deletions(-) diff --git a/apps/dashboard/app/(app)/apis/[apiId]/_components/create-key/components/expiration-setup.tsx b/apps/dashboard/app/(app)/apis/[apiId]/_components/create-key/components/expiration-setup.tsx index fb79d6ddba..dfdfc5b190 100644 --- a/apps/dashboard/app/(app)/apis/[apiId]/_components/create-key/components/expiration-setup.tsx +++ b/apps/dashboard/app/(app)/apis/[apiId]/_components/create-key/components/expiration-setup.tsx @@ -123,8 +123,7 @@ export const ExpirationSetup = () => { // Calculate date for showing warning about close expiry (less than 1 hour) const isExpiringVerySoon = - currentExpiryDate && - new Date(currentExpiryDate).getTime() - new Date().getTime() < 60 * 60 * 1000; + currentExpiryDate && new Date(currentExpiryDate).getTime() - Date.now() < 60 * 60 * 1000; const getExpiryDescription = () => { if (isExpiringVerySoon) { diff --git a/apps/dashboard/app/(app)/apis/[apiId]/_components/create-key/create-key.schema.ts b/apps/dashboard/app/(app)/apis/[apiId]/_components/create-key/create-key.schema.ts index 3dcf53cb0d..40af92373b 100644 --- a/apps/dashboard/app/(app)/apis/[apiId]/_components/create-key/create-key.schema.ts +++ b/apps/dashboard/app/(app)/apis/[apiId]/_components/create-key/create-key.schema.ts @@ -209,7 +209,7 @@ export const expirationValidationSchema = z.object({ }) .refine( (date) => { - const minDate = new Date(new Date().getTime() + 2 * 60000); + const minDate = new Date(Date.now() + 2 * 60000); return date >= minDate; }, { diff --git a/apps/dashboard/components/ui/chart.tsx b/apps/dashboard/components/ui/chart.tsx index 88b573460c..4e82c8b01a 100644 --- a/apps/dashboard/components/ui/chart.tsx +++ b/apps/dashboard/components/ui/chart.tsx @@ -73,6 +73,7 @@ const ChartStyle = ({ id, config }: { id: string; config: ChartConfig }) => { return (